NCP candidate Maharjan for IT hub in Kirtipur, expanding Kirtipur-Makwanpur road

By TRN Online, Kathmandu, Feb 25: Rupa Maharjan, the candidate of Nepali Communist Party (NCP) for Kathmandu constituency 10 for the election to the House of Representatives (HoR), has expressed commitment to develop Kirtipur as an IT hub and generate employment.

In her commitment, she has also mentioned about expansion of the Kirtipur-Makawanpur road, upgrading public schools and colleges, advancing Hattiban-Champadevi-Chandragiri trekking route and run public buses by developing road Chandragiri-Kirtipur-Dhakshinkali road.

She has also made commitment to give a concrete shape to ethnic museum at Champadevi.

NCP candidate Maharjan has also pledged to arrange for adequate and proper drinking water for all the residents in the constituency while paying due attention to conservation of the water base area.

She has made it a point that she would take initiative for federal budget to develop her constituency as a model area with regard to economic, social and cultural development.
